Reading 8 Digital Life Skills All Children need  I started to think more about the section about the neglect of digital citizenship. I often feel left in the dark when I hear this because I grew up as a millennial with technology but also because the school district I work in is always embracing technology and trying to incorporate it into our teaching with ease. We have begun to use code.org in the last few years and even just this year I received a  Cubetto. 


"A child should start learning digital citizenship as early as possible, ideally when one starts actively using games, social media or any digital device."

I admit I use to believe most of the safe use of technology should rely on the parents. However after teaching for the last 5 years I have discovered that parents also lack training and knowledge to do so in many cases. Now living in the area we do parents often work at places like Microsoft, Boeing, and Amazon therefore they often have some great skills with digital devices. We have their children for 7 hours of the day so that puts a heavy responsibility on teachers to teach and model digital citizenship in the classroom. I also feel our school districts and communities need to continue or start to acknowledge this need for digital citizenship before we get too fr behind.
